Chapter One — The Reunion

Vivienne Carter was not drunk. She wanted to be clear about that, later, when the police asked questions. She was not drunk, she was not having a breakdown, and she was absolutely not—as Jack would suggest with that infuriating half-smile of his—"going through a thing."

She was simply standing at her twenty-five-year college reunion, holding a glass of champagne that had been topped off so many times she'd lost count, listening to Brenda Holloway describe prison visiting hours with the serene contentment of a woman discussing a spa retreat.

"Tuesdays and Saturdays," Brenda said, swirling her vodka tonic. "I go on Tuesdays. We play Scrabble. He's gotten very good at Scrabble—apparently there's nothing else to do."

"Brenda." Vivienne set down her champagne with the deliberate care of a woman trying to signal that this conversation had taken a turn she had not anticipated. "Your husband is in federal prison."

"Minimum security."

"That's still prison."
